Food is a crucial element of any wedding, especially in Muslim culture, where the menu should reflect traditional tastes while also accommodating dietary restrictions. With a budget of C$205,920 to C$410,880 for food, caterers can provide a lavish spread featuring halal options, including a variety of appetizers, main courses, and desserts. Buffet-style dining or plated service can be tailored to fit the event's theme and guest preferences.

Planning a 2-day Muslim wedding celebration typically starts 12-18 months in advance. This allows ample time for venue selection, catering, and coordinating events to ensure a seamless experience.
To manage Calgary's cold winters, consider indoor venues like the Hyatt Regency Calgary, provide heat lamps for outdoor areas, and ensure guests are informed about appropriate attire for the weather.
When selecting a venue, consider capacity, catering options, accessibility for guests, and cultural requirements. Venues like the Hyatt Regency Calgary offer luxurious settings that can accommodate large gatherings.
To manage your budget for a large Muslim wedding, prioritize essential services, compare vendor quotes, and consider off-peak dates for potential discounts. Always keep track of expenses to stay within budget.
